details>.search-modal{display:flex;height:max-content}details>.search-modal hr{margin-block:4rem}details[open]>.search-modal{opacity:1;animation:animateSearchOpen var(--duration-default)}details:not([open]) .search-modal__close-button .icon{transform:rotate(0) scale(1)}.search-modal--overflow{overflow-y:auto}.no-js details[open]>.header__icon--search{top:1rem;right:.5rem}.search-modal{opacity:1;top:100%;bottom:unset;width:100%;height:0;z-index:13}.search-modal__top{display:flex;align-items:center;justify-content:flex-end;gap:.8rem;width:100%}.search-modal .search__products{overflow-x:scroll}.search__products h4{text-transform:initial;margin:24px 0 20px;font-size:18px;font-weight:400;line-height:24px}.search__products .card__title,.predictive-search__results-groups-wrapper .card__title{margin:0}.search__products .predictive-search__results-list{display:grid}@media screen and (min-width: 990px){.search__products .predictive-search__results-list_products{width:calc(100% - 232px)}.search__products h4{font-size:20px}.search__items{padding-left:48px;padding-right:48px}}@media screen and (min-width: 1200px){.search-modal .search__products{overflow:hidden}}.search-modal .search__items-list{display:grid;justify-content:space-between;grid-template-columns:repeat(3,30rem);margin:0;padding:0;list-style:none}@media screen and (min-width: 1200px){.search-modal .search__items-list{grid-template-columns:repeat(3,1fr)}}.search-modal .search__items-item{flex:none;padding:0;background-color:rgb(var(--color-background-card))}@media screen and (min-width: 990px){.search-modal .search__items-item:hover .card-extended-wrapper__image{opacity:1;transform:scale(1.05)}.search-modal .search__items-item:hover .placeholder-svg{transform:scale(1.05)}.search-modal .search__items-item:hover .media.media--hover-effect>img:first-child:not(:only-of-type){opacity:0;transform:scale(1.12);transition:transform var(--duration-long) ease,opacity var(--duration-long) ease}.search-modal .search__items-item:hover .media.media--hover-effect>img+img{opacity:1;transform:scale(1.1);transition:transform var(--duration-long) ease,opacity var(--duration-long) ease}.search-modal .search__items-item:hover .media.media--hover-effect>img{transform:scale(1.12);transition:transform var(--duration-long) ease,opacity var(--duration-long) ease}}.search-modal .search__items-item .card-horizontal-wrapper{height:100%;padding-left:2.4rem;padding-right:2.4rem;border-right:none;border-left:.1rem solid rgb(var(--color-border))}@media screen and (min-width: 1200px){.search-modal .search__items-item .card-horizontal-wrapper{padding-left:4rem;padding-right:4rem}}@media screen and (min-width: 1440px){.search-modal .search__items-item .card-horizontal-wrapper{padding-left:6rem}}.search-modal .search__items-item .card-horizontal-wrapper .price-item,.search-modal .search__items-item .card-horizontal-wrapper .price .price__sale .price-item--regular{font-size:1.2rem}.search-modal .search__items-item .card-horizontal-wrapper .card-horizontal__link{padding:.5rem}.search-modal .search__items-item:first-child .card-horizontal-wrapper{padding-left:0;border:none}.search-modal .search__items-item:last-child .card-horizontal-wrapper{padding-right:0}.search-modal .search__items .card-horizontal__information{justify-content:space-between;margin:0;padding-block:2.5rem;max-width:20rem;height:100%}.search-modal .search__items .subtitle{margin-top:0;margin-bottom:.2rem;line-height:1.5}.search-modal .search__items .card-horizontal__title{margin-bottom:.8rem;text-transform:none;line-height:1.5}.search-modal__item{background-color:var(--color-white);padding:19px 0 22px;border-bottom-left-radius:32px;border-bottom-right-radius:32px}@media screen and (min-width: 990px){.search-modal__item{padding:22px 0 24px}}details[open] .search-modal__item{position:relative;display:flex;align-items:flex-start;flex-direction:column;width:100%;height:max-content;animation:animateSearchOpacity .5s ease}details[open] .search-modal__item .header__heading,details[open] .search-modal__item .header__heading-link{order:0;margin-bottom:4.8rem}details[open] .search-modal__item .header__heading .header__heading-link{margin-bottom:0}details[open] .search-modal__item .search-modal__close-button{display:inline-flex;transform:translate(1.6rem)}.search-modal.modal__content{position:fixed}.search-modal .card-horizontal__link{min-width:8rem}.search-modal__overlay{position:absolute;right:0;bottom:0;left:0;top:0;height:100vh;background-color:rgba(var(--color-overlay),.8)}.search-modal__content{display:inline-flex;flex-direction:column;align-items:flex-start;justify-content:center;width:100%}.search-modal__form{position:relative;width:100%}.search-modal__form .field .field__input+label{top:16px;left:24px;color:var(--color-green-40);transform:none}.search__form-inner{position:relative;display:flex;flex-direction:column}.search-modal__content .field__label{color:var(--color-green-40)}@media screen and (min-width: 750px){.search__form-inner{display:block}.search__form-inner .field{max-width:820px}}@media screen and (max-width: 989px){.search-modal__content{padding-right:0}.predictive-search__result-tabs,.search-modal__content .field{padding-right:20px}}.search__form-inner .field input[type=search]{background-color:var(--color-white);border:1px solid var(--color-green-20);border-radius:32px;padding:16px 150px 16px 24px}.search__form-inner .field input[type=search]::placeholder{color:var(--color-green-40)}.search__form-inner .field input[type=search]:focus-visible{border:0}.search__input.field__input{min-height:56px;height:56px}@media screen and (min-width: 750px){.search__input.field__input{padding-right:15rem}}.search__input.field__input:hover:not(:focus){border-color:rgb(var(--color-border-input-hover))}.search-modal__content .field{flex-grow:1;width:auto}.search-modal__heading{text-transform:none}.search-modal__heading p{margin:0}.search-modal__content .field__label{left:6.1rem}@media screen and (min-width: 750px){.search__button{position:absolute;right:.8rem;top:50%;min-width:10.8rem;min-height:5rem;transform:translateY(-50%)}}.search-modal__collections{margin-top:3.5rem;margin-bottom:-2.5rem;width:100%}.search-modal__collections h2{width:100%;font-family:var(--font-heading-family);font-style:var(--font-heading-style);font-weight:var(--font-heading-weight);letter-spacing:.06rem;color:rgb(var(--color-foreground));line-height:1.3;word-wrap:break-word;max-width:100%;text-transform:none;margin:0 0 1rem}@keyframes animateSearchOpen{0%{opacity:0}to{opacity:1}}@keyframes animateSearchOpacity{0%{opacity:0}50%{opacity:0}to{opacity:1}}input::-webkit-search-decoration{-webkit-appearance:none}.search-modal .search__subtitle.subtitle{margin-bottom:.8rem}.search__categories{border-bottom:1px solid var(--color-green-20);margin-top:24px;padding-bottom:22px;width:100%}.search__products .collection-product-card.quickview--hover:hover .media.media--hover-effect>img{border-radius:20px}@media screen and (max-width: 990px){.search__categories{border-bottom:none;padding-bottom:0}.search__categories-wrapper{margin-right:20px;padding-bottom:20px;border-bottom:1px solid var(--color-green-20)}}.search__categories.hide{display:none}.search__categories-list{display:flex;align-items:center;justify-content:flex-start;gap:.8rem;margin:0;padding:0;width:100%;list-style:none}.search__categories-item{display:flex;align-items:center;justify-content:flex-start;flex:none}.search__categories-item .search__categories-link{cursor:pointer;position:relative;display:flex;align-items:center;justify-content:center;margin-bottom:0;padding:8px 20px;text-align:center;background-color:var(--color-turquiose);border:1px solid var(--color-turquiose);color:var(--color-green);border-radius:32px;transition:all var(--duration-default);font-size:14px;font-weight:500;line-height:24px;letter-spacing:.56px;text-transform:uppercase;text-decoration:none;letter-spacing:normal;z-index:1}.search__categories-item .search__categories-link:after{display:none}.search__line.hide,.search__promo-block.hide{display:none}@media screen and (max-width: 381px){.line-divider:after{margin-left:3px;margin-right:3px}.search__articles{margin-top:3.2rem}.search-modal__form{margin-top:0}}.template-search__search .field .field__input+label{top:2.2rem;transform:none}@media screen and (min-width: 990px){.template-search__search .field .field__input+label{top:50%;transform:translateY(-50%)}.search-modal__content{padding-left:48px}}@media screen and (max-width: 575px){.container.search__promo-block{padding-right:0}.search__products .predictive-search__results-list{display:grid;justify-content:space-between;grid-template-columns:repeat(3,30rem);margin:0;padding:0;list-style:none}.search__categories-list{flex-wrap:wrap}.predictive-search__results-list .card__title a,.container.search__promo-block .card__title a{font-size:18px;font-weight:400;line-height:24px}.predictive-search__results-list .price-item,.container.search__promo-block .price-item{color:var(--color-green)!important;font-size:16px!important;font-weight:400;line-height:24px}}
/*# sourceMappingURL=/cdn/shop/t/133/assets/component-search.css.map */
